Philip Joseph Credle, Jr.

Friday, January 21, 2022

Philip Joseph Credle, Jr., 81, of Blytheville, passed away Monday, Jan. 17, 2022, at Great River Medical Center in Blytheville.

Philip was born in Norfolk, Vir., to Philip and Elizabeth Fleming Credle. He served his country with honor in the United States Air Force during the Vietnam War. Philip retired from the Air Force as a tech sergeant after 20 years of service. After retirement, Philip served as the Blytheville City Collector for 23 years. He was an active, faithful member of First United Methodist Church, was the past master of the Masonic Lodge and was a Shriner. Philip was an avid outdoorsman and loved to hunt and fish.

He was preceded in death by his parents.

Philip is survived by his wife, Florence Ambrose Credle of the home; son, Kent Ritchey of Holly Springs, Miss., and daughter, Robin Fritchman of Little Rock; grandchildren, Rob Moore, Alexx Conley, Jake Ritchey, Cole Ritchey, Jack Ritchey and Jacqueline Fritchman; great-grandson, Reed Ritchey; and best friend, Harold Cole of Blytheville.

Funeral services were held Thursday, Jan. 20, at 11 a.m. in the Cobb Funeral Home Chapel with Rev. Zach Roberts officiating. Burial followed in Elmwood Cemetery. The family received friends from 10 a.m. until service time at Cobb Funeral Home. The family request memorials be made in Philip’s honor to the First United Methodist Church Building Fund or to the Blytheville Humane Society.
